8 Excel APIs & Free Alternatives List - April, 2024 | RapidAPI (2024)

About Excel APIs

There are several Excel APIs that are available from Microsoft and other developers. These APIs do everything from those that convert Excel to APIs for use in other applications to convert Excel sheets to PDF files and more.

What is an Excel API?

Microsoft’s primary Excel API allows developers to access data stored within Excel sheets to perform calculations outside of the application. While that is the goal of most Excel APIs, other APIs access Excel data, convert it to other formats or use the API to convert data in another format to CSV files for Excel use.

How do Excel APIs work?

Excel APIs work by accessing the Excel worksheet or workbook and using it within another application. It might transform the data by doing calculations. It could display the data graphically or merely convert the data for import into another application.

Who are Excel APIs for exactly?

Developers who wish to access data stored in Excel worksheets will fine the primary API from Microsoft to be of great benefit. Other users, such as those who want to convert the data contained within Excel to another format or those with raw data who wish to make that data available in Excel, will find this type of API useful.

Why are Excel APIs important?

Excel APIs are important because they allow developers to use data stored in Excel for other applications. For most businesses, Excel is an easy way to enter and maintain data, rather than using a more complicated database application. To convert Excel to API output for use in other applications, companies can economically use their data.

What can you expect from Excel APIs?

Excel online APIs allow you to convert Excel data to graphs, charts, and presentations in many other applications. Excel APIs can also feed data into other types of databases as well. Because the tools for using APIs with Excel are based on the Excel application itself, developers can use existing APIs or create their own quite readily.

Are there examples of free Excel APIs?

Not only are there dozens of free Excel APIs available from sites like RapidAPI, Microsoft has a large library of APIs for use with its software, which includes not only Excel but Microsoft Graphs and Visual Basic as well. The base toolset within Excel also allows developers to create their own Excel online APIs and easily.

Best Excel APIs

  1. Excelerant
  2. Create PDF from JSON or CSV Data
  3. CSV Importer
  4. Excelon
  5. Google Sheets

Excel API SDKs

All Excel APIs are supported and made available in multiple developer programming languages and SDKs including:

  1. Node.js
  2. PHP
  3. Python
  4. Ruby
  5. Objective-C
  6. Java (Android)
  7. C# (.NET)
  8. cURL

Just select your preference from any API endpoints page.

Sign up today for free on RapidAPI to begin using Excel APIs!

8 Excel APIs & Free Alternatives List - April, 2024 | RapidAPI (2024)

FAQs

What is the free alternative to Excel? ›

Google Sheets may be the most popular spreadsheet web app, but Zoho Sheet has more features, and it's also completely free. It's the best free Excel alternative, if you're looking for the most powerful solution.

Does Excel have Apis? ›

You can use the Excel REST API in Microsoft Graph to extend the value of your Excel data, calculations, reporting, and dashboards.

How do I see API responses? ›

An API response consists of the response body, headers, cookies, and the HTTP status code. You can view details about the response, including test results, network information, response size, response time, and security warnings. You can also save responses as examples or files.

How do I get responses from API? ›

We use the fetch() function to make a POST request to the specified URL (https://api.example.com/users) with the request options. We handle the response using . then() and check if it's successful by accessing the response. ok property.

What is the new alternative to Excel? ›

Google Sheets

Brought to you by the Google Drive suite of apps, Google Sheets is a top-tier choice for anyone looking for an Excel alternative. This cloud-based spreadsheet app has many of the same features as Excel (charts, formulas, and real-time collaboration), making it the best free Excel alternative.

Does Google have a free version of Excel? ›

Google Sheets is more user-friendly and accessible; Excel is more advanced. If you're looking for a basic spreadsheet app at no cost to you, Google Sheets has you covered.

What is Excel API? ›

An API is a 'bridge' through which one app obtains/sends information from/to another app. This means that you can load miscellaneous data from your source app to your Excel workbook using the REST API.

What does API mean? ›

API stands for Application Programming Interface. In the context of APIs, the word Application refers to any software with a distinct function. Interface can be thought of as a contract of service between two applications. This contract defines how the two communicate with each other using requests and responses.

What is the difference between VBA and API in Excel? ›

What's the difference between VBA and API? VBA applications process from within the program shell. API applications process while the program shell is closed.

Is the Excel app no longer free? ›

You can use Microsoft Office apps for free. Microsoft 365 is the most recent version of the Microsoft Office set of tools, and it includes programs you already use at home, school or work.

Does Microsoft have a free Excel? ›

Free Online Spreadsheet Software: Excel. Microsoft 365.

How to convert API response to CSV? ›

The temporary DataFrame is then appended to the final DataFrame df using df. append(). After the for loop is completed, the code prints the shape of the final DataFrame df, the first five rows of the DataFrame, and then saves the DataFrame as a CSV file. Finally, the code uses the files.

How to get data from API request? ›

The Base URL (also called the Request URL) is the URL that you need to use to access the API. Look for these terms in the API docs. The Endpoint is where the data that you want to interact with is located. You add it to the base URL after a forward slash / .

Top Articles
Latest Posts
Article information

Author: Tyson Zemlak

Last Updated:

Views: 6296

Rating: 4.2 / 5 (43 voted)

Reviews: 82% of readers found this page helpful

Author information

Name: Tyson Zemlak

Birthday: 1992-03-17

Address: Apt. 662 96191 Quigley Dam, Kubview, MA 42013

Phone: +441678032891

Job: Community-Services Orchestrator

Hobby: Coffee roasting, Calligraphy, Metalworking, Fashion, Vehicle restoration, Shopping, Photography

Introduction: My name is Tyson Zemlak, I am a excited, light, sparkling, super, open, fair, magnificent person who loves writing and wants to share my knowledge and understanding with you.